About the Event
Description: Curious about transitioning into the pharmaceutical industry, gaining international experience, and making a difference in patients’ lives? During this interactive Zoom event, we’ll explore the Novo Nordisk Graduate Programme and how it can help accelerate a career within the pharmaceutical industry. You will hear insights from two Novo Nordisk graduates on their journey from master’s degree to global headquarters. Following the presentation, you will also have the opportunity to network with Novo Nordisk employees from global headquarters and Canada.
Objectives:
- Provide an overview of Pharma with a focus on departments that typically hire STEM graduates.
- Profile Novo Nordisk, the Novo Nordisk Graduate Programme, and the application process.
- Discuss the benefits of starting your career at a Global Headquarters
- Network with Novo Nordisk employees from Global Headquarters and Canada

Biographies:
Iida Tynkkynen, MSc
Iida has recently graduated with a Master’s degree in Medical Management from Karolinska Institutet, where she conducted a research project in psychiatry as part of her studies. She is now on her first rotation in Medical Writing as part of the Novo Nordisk Graduate Programme in Regulatory, Medical & Safety. Iida has a strong interest in patient-centricity, non-communicable diseases and health care systems.
Amanda Fantin, MSc
Amanda is recent a graduate from the University of Toronto with a MSc in Physiology. Her research focused on stem cells and diabetes, in particular the role of the extracellular matrix in influencing cell fate towards pancreatic cell types. She is currently in her first rotation of the Novo Nordisk Graduate Program working in the Global Chief Medical Office within Strategic Operations. Amanda is passionate about bridging the gap between the scientific and medical communities.
